CopyCAM

SO I work as an interior designer to a commercial firm who is a furniture vendor and our main furniture line is Steelcase, which is like the Cadillac of Commercial furniture. Anyway....there is a product called the CopyCAM that we have on our showroom floor to be able to use for meetings and product knowledge. It's basically a devise used above whiteboards that can capture notes taken during a meeting to be email, printed or saved to anyone in the meeting. No more taking notes!!! Steelcase is the leader in making your office space a place that you love because of efficiency and comfort. In an effort to keep things not too serious....I copyCAM'ed myself today.
